People tend to worry about catching exotic illnesses overseas, but injuries are the leading preventable cause of death in travelers.2Motor vehicle crashes not crime or terrorism are the number 1 killer of healthy US citizens living, working, or traveling overseas, according to the Centers for Disease Control.2Other causes of trauma include scooter/moped accidents and assault. Destitute U.S. citizens in need of help overseas should contact the nearest U.S. embassy or consulate or the U.S. Department of State, Office of Overseas Citizens Services, at (888) 407-4747 (or from overseas +1 202-501-4444), for information about other assistance options and eligibility requirements. Some countries require foreign visitors to carry an International Certificate of Vaccination, also known as a Yellow Card, or other proof that they have had certain inoculations or medical tests before entering or transiting the country.
